Barapullah phase IV will link airport

New Delhi: Union Home Minister Rajnath Singh on Tuesday laid the foundation stone for Barapullah phase III, which will connect East and South Delhi. The corridor is expected to be extended till the Indira Gandhi International Airport as part of phase IV.
Although Singh claimed that tenders for the project had been issued, BJP MP Maheish Girri clarified that the process was under way and that it was a mere “procedural matter”. PWD officials later said that the tendering process will begin within a week. While the deadline for completion of phase III has been fixed at December 2017, Singh announced that the project will be completed six months earlier.
“There is need to minimise traffic congestion on roads and we want to build such infrastructure across India to decongest roads. The third phase of Barapullah will be useful for the people of East and South Delhi. This project will be completed by June 2017,” Singh said.
